I believe goes "live" some time in June/early July. Most people submit apps by mid to late August. Like every thing else in life, the earlier the better. However, you have to balance applying early with the quality of your app. If you have a bomb ass ophtho rec letter in the making, delaying the application by a week or so can help you.

Couple of questions for clarification:
1) There's a function to upload college transcript. However, we also have to mail in the college transcript as part of the package. Are we supposed to do both or just the snail mail?

2) Isn't the dean's letter mailed in separately by the medical school or not? I don't think it's distributed until October....

3) One of my LORs is from an August rotation meaning that it will not be ready until early-mid September. If everything is mailed in besides that letter before the due date, will the application still be considered complete? I heard this is a common thing done by other applicants.

Thanks! Good luck to everyone applying this year!

I'll try to answer to the best of my abilities.
1) When I was applying last cycle the only option we had was to snail mail the college transcript, uploading was not an option. If I was in your shoes, yes I'd do both.

2) The Dean's letter or MSPE IS mailed by the school. Release date for us was Oct 15th or something. Just keep reminding your school periodically that you are an ophtho applicant and it should work out just fine.

3)Without the LOR I do not think your application will be considered complete. That being said I don't think early to mid september is that late.
